Niuroa
Niuroa is a valley in Windward Islands, French Polynesia. Niuroa is situated nearby to the village Afareaitu, as well as near the locality Paorea.Places of Interest

Mount Tohivea
Peak
Photo: Olivier Bruchez,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Mount Tohivea is the highest point on the island of Mo'orea in French Polynesia at 1,207 metres. The mountain is about 3.2 kilometres south of the settlement of Pao Pao, and is easily visible from the west coast of nearby Tahiti, approximately 24 kilometres to the east.
